Failed findings

  • handwashing sink issuescritical
    Official wording: Sanitizing Rinse For Equipment And Utensils: Clean, Proper Temperature, Concentration, Exposure Time
    Inspector note: OBSERVED EMPLOYEE WASHING AND RINSING MULTI USE UTENSILS AND SETTING THEM TO DRY, HOWEVER NOT USING A SANITIZING METHOD. INSTRUCTED/DEMOSTRATED PROPER SET UP OF 3PART SINK USING 100PPM CHLORINE FOR PROPER SANITATION. CRITICAL CITATION ISSUED, 7-38-030.
    code 8Priority
  • Food In Original Container, Properly Labeled: Customer Advisory Posted As Needed
    Inspector note: PREP FOODS INSIDE TWO DOOR STORAGE COOLER NOT LABELED, INSTRUCTED TO DATE/LABEL AND MAINTAIN.
    code 30
  • food prep surfaces dirty
    Official wording: Food And Non-Food Contact Equipment Utensils Clean, Free Of Abrasive Detergents
    Inspector note: THE FOLLOWING NOT CLEANED, INSTRUCTED TO CLEAN/SANITIZE; COOLERS, COOKING EQUIPMENT, STORAGE SHELVES UNDER FRONT SERVING COUNTERS, FREEZERS, MICROWAVE OVEN, AND REMOVE CARDBOARDS AND FOIL COVERING FROM EQUIPMENT.
    code 33
  • Floors: Constructed Per Code, Cleaned, Good Repair, Coving Installed, Dust-Less Cleaning Methods Used
    Inspector note: INSTRUCTED TO CLEAN FLOORS, UNDER, BEHIND EQUIPMENT AT CORNERS AND ALONG WALLS THRU-OUT PREP AREAS AND STORAGE AREAS.
    code 34
  • Walls, Ceilings, Attached Equipment Constructed Per Code: Good Repair, Surfaces Clean And Dust-Less Cleaning Methods
    Inspector note: MUST SEAL OPENINGS ON BOTTOM OF EAST WALL INSIDE THE STORAGE ROOM, REPLACE MISSING FILTERS UNDER HOOD AT REAR PREP AREA, CLEAN VENT COVERS AND LIGHT SHIELDS THRU-OUT.
    code 35
  • grimy wiping cloths
    Official wording: Premises Maintained Free Of Litter, Unnecessary Articles, Cleaning Equipment Properly Stored
    Inspector note: INSTRUCTED TO REMOVE UNNECESSARY ARTICLES THRU-OUT STORAGE AREAS, CLEAN AND ORGANIZE TO PREVENT PEST HARBORAGE. ARTICLES MUST BE STORED OFF FLOORS, AWAY FROM WALLS.
    code 41
  • Food (Ice) Dispensing Utensils, Wash Cloths Properly Stored
    Inspector note: INSTRCTED, CLEANING TOWELS MUST BE PROPERLY STORED.
    code 43
